kevin saunderson, juan atkins, and derrick may are all more or less equal in the birth of Detroit techno. In fact they all went to the same high school. Saunderson's "Electronic Dance" released as K.S. Experience is considered an early detroit classic. He was behind KMS Records, based in Detroit, which was certainly seminal in the birth of the entire genre of techno with releases also involved with Inner City ("Big Fun" and "Good Life") as a songwriter, producer and mixer. He certainly doesn't have the prominance today that his fellow detroiters enjoy, but he certainly belongs in the techno hall of fame. Mark Edward Bowen Warmed Breakdown mb@gettins.bche.uic.edu
